Canned Red Kidney Beans With Liquids VS Cooked Teff Nutrients Per 500 Kcal
Discover which food has more nutrients per 500 calories -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ids or Cooked Teff?
Lets compare vitamin content per 500 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ids vs Cooked Teff:
- 500 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have 2.5 times more Vitamin B2 and 1.6 times more Vitamin B9 than Cooked Teff.
- While 500 kcal of Cooked Teff contain 1.4 times more Vitamin B1 and 1.5 times more Vitamin B3 than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ids.
-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Cooked Teff provide similar amounts of Vitamin B6 per 500 calories.
- Both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ids as well as Cooked Teff have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in B12 in 500 calories.
Comparing minerals per 500 calories for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ids vs Cooked Teff:
- 500 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have 3 times more Potassium, 39.9 times more Sodium and 1.3 times more Water than Cooked Teff.
- While 500 kcal of Cooked Teff contain 1.4 times more Calcium, 1.3 times more Iron, 1.3 times more Magnesium, 7.9 times more Manganese and 1.4 times more Zinc than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ids.
-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Cooked Teff contain similar levels of Copper and Phosphorus per 500 calories.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 500 calories:
- 500 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have 1.9 times more Fiber and 1.7 times more Protein than Cooked Teff.
-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Cooked Teff off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per 500 calories.
